Precautions
Do not install the camera in extreme temperature conditions.
Do not touch the front lens of the camera.
Never keep the camera pointed directly at strong light.
Do not expose the camera to radioactivity.
Do not install the camera under unstable lighting conditions.
Do not drop the camera or subject it to physical shocks.
Only use the camera under conditions where temperatures are between
-10°C and +50°C. Be especially careful to provide ventilation when operating under high temperatures.
This is one of the most important parts of the camera. Be careful not to leave fingerprints on the lens cover.
It can cause malfunctions to occur.
If exposed to radioactivity the CCD will fail.
Severe lighting change or flicker can cause the camera to work improperly.
Housing damage can compromise weatherproof ratings.

BRIGHTNESS : The brightness can be adjusted. The brightness control range is 1~20.
SHUTTER : DC lens is launched with the setting of 1/30 and the manual lens is launched
with the setting of Auto shutter, but the shutter speed can be adjusted from 1/30 to 1/30,000.
→ FLK : Select FLK mode if flickering occurs ; caused by the unmatched frequency of electric light.
NOTE
* Sense-Up mode does not work when Electronic shutter is set to Manual.
INTENSIFY : Brightness will be increased automatically depending on the circumstance of low light
condition.
Off ~x32 Level Adjustable.
AGC (Auto Gain Control) : The higher the AGC level is, the more noises appear.
0~20 Level selectable.
White Balance
Use this function when the color adjustment of a screen is needed.
1. Move the triangular indicator to WHITE BAL on the SETUP menu screen using the Up and Down button.
2. Select the desired mode by using the left or Right button.
MENU
1.LENS
2.EXPOSURE
3.WHITE BAL
4.BACKLIGHT
5.SPECO DNR
6.DAY&NIGHT
7.IMAGE
8.MOTION
9.SYSTEM RETURN
DC
AUTO
OFF MIDDEL AUTO
OFF
31
MANUAL
KELVIN R-GAIN B-GAIN RETURN
MIDDLE |IIIIIIIII|IIIIIIIII| 10 |IIIIIIIII|IIIIIIIII| 10
AUT0 : Use this mode when the color temperature is from 2,500k to 9,500k.
AWB : The function to search for the color which is matched well with the ambient environment.
AWCSET : After letting camera focus on the blank white paper to the best condition of current
lighting environment, press the SET button. If the lighting condition is changed, Re-adjustment
should be needed.
MANUAL : Manual compensation make the more detailed control possible. First, after adjusting the
white balance using the ATW or AWB mode, change the mode into the manual compensation mode and then press Set button. While looking at the color change of the subject seen on the screen after setting up the proper color temperature, increase the each value of the blue and the red.
- KELVIN : LOW/MIDDLE/HIGH level adjustable.
- R-GAIN : 0~20 level adjustable.
- B-GAIN : 0~20 level adjustable.
- Return : Every function is set up at the EXPOSURE menu, and then return the previous menu.
NOTE
White Balance may not work properly in the following conditions. If this doesn’t work, use the AWB mode. * When there is a very high color temperature in the circumstances of the subject.
( for example, clear sky, Sunset)
*▶It is very dark. *▶If the camera is pointed directly at fluorescent light or if there is a drastic lighting
change, The operation of White balance may become unstable.

BACKLIGHT
On this menu, backlight image can be compensated by users selecting one of modees.(HLC, BLC, WDR)
1. Move the triangular indicator to BACKLIGHT on the SETUP menu screen using the Up and Down button.
2. Select the desired mode by using the left or Right button.
Off : Deactivated status.
HLC : This fuction is used to surpress or strong light source (for example, headlights of cars during
nighttime) so that other subjects can be seen in more detail. If you select HCL, a submenu appears where you can make finer adjustments.
- LEVEL : Adjust the brightness level from which on the light source is to be masked out. 0~20 level adjustable.
- MODE : All day/night only adjustable.

BLC : This fuction is used to counterbalance the screen image by increasing the brightness so that a
subject which appears dark due to a strong backlight can be displayed in more detail. If you select BLC, a submenu appears where you can make finer adjustments.
- H-POS/V-POS/H-SIZE/V-SIZE : Define the position and size of the area of interest by changing the position & size.
WDR : The WDR (Wide Dynamic Range) fuction works to correct excessive light within the frame to
produce a usable image. When the image has simultaneous bright and dark areas, it makes both areas distinct. If you select WDR, a submenu appears where you can make finer adjustments.
- WEIGHT [MIDDLE, HIGH, LOW] : Select the WDR level of the camera.
34
SPECO DNR
This fuction is used to improve the picture quality by filtering the noise which is generated under low bright
light conditions. You can set different levels here.
1. Move the triangular indicator to SPECO DNR by useing the Up and Down button.
2. Select the mode to use by pressing the left or Right button and LOW/MIDDLE/HIGH level selectable.

Day&Night
You can change the color mode of color or black / white by setting up the mode.
1. Select Day&Night using the Up or Down button on the Set Up menu screen.
2. Select the desired mode using the Left or Right buttons.
35
AUTO : Automatically, It shifts into the color mode in the bright environment and the B/W mode in the
low light condition. It can adjust the delay time, starting brightness and end brightness according to the
ambient conditions by pressing the Set button.
- SMART IR : 0~20 smart IR level adjustable.
- AGC THRES : 0~20 AGC THRES level adjustable.
- AGC MARGIN : 0~20 AGC MARGIN level adjustable.
- DELAY [LOW/MIDDLE/HIGH] : Set the delay time for switching between COLOR and B/W
- SMART IR : It controls the IR LED(bright portion base), satuation is not expected.
0~20 level adjustable.
COLOR : Making the video output color always.
B / W : Making the video output B/W always.
EXTERN : It can change the color or B/W mode automatically through the connection with the ground
terminal.(Option for box camera and IR camera)
- SMART IR : It controls the IR LED(bright portion base), satuation is not expected. 0~20 level adjustable.

- EXTERN S/W [LOW/HIGH] : Set the external signal for switching between COLOR and B/W.
- DELAY [LOW/MIDDLE/HIGH] : Set the delay time for switching between color and B/W .
- SHARPNESS [1 ~ 20] : Adjusts the image sharpness. If the level goes up excessively, it may affect the video image and generate a noise.
- GAMMA [0.45 ~ 0.65] : Changes the gamma curve of the camera.
- COLOR GAIN [0 ~ 20] : Changes the color gain of the camera.
- MIRROR [ON, OFF] : Mirrors the image horizontally on the screen.
- FLIP [ON, OFF] : Flips the image vertically on the screen.
37
- D-ZOOM : You can use the digital zoom with x1~x8 magnification. The higher the digital zoom
magnification is, the lower the resolution is.
- ACE [LOW/MIDDLE/HIGH] : Intelligent lightn level control to over come even strong backlight conditions.
- DEFOG [ON, OFF] : This fuction helps to recognize the object in a dusty weather condition. ON, a submenu appears where you can make finer adjustments.
- SHADING [ON, OFF] : Compensates the shading effects of lenses when the lens is set to a very wide
angle. This function will reduce the brightness difference between the centre and the edges. If you select
ON, a submenu appears where you can make finer adjustments.
PRIVACY [ON, OFF] : This is used to hide certain areas on the monitor. You can designate each different
16 area. The size of a designated area can be adjusted. The color of a privacy area can be selected various colors. When you select the return, the setting values in this function menu are saved, then get
out of this menu.
- ZONE NUM [0~15] : Select a mask out of the 16 mask areas and set the options below for the selected
mask.
- ZONE DISP [ON, OFF] : Choose ON to activate privacy masks and press OFF to deactivate masks.
- H-POS [0~60] : Define the horizontal start position of the privacy mask.
- V-POS [0~33] : Define the vertical start position of the privacy mask.
- H-ZISE [0~60] : Define the horizontal size of the privacy mask.
- V-SIZE [0~33] : Define the vertical size of the privacy mask.
- Y LEVEL [0~20] : Define the brightness of the mask color.
- CR LEVEL [0~20] : Define the red amount of the mask color.
- CB LEVEL [0~20] : Define the blue amount of the mask color.

- COM. : This menu id used for RS-485 communication. Users are able to select 'CAM ID(0~255)' and 'BAU DRATE(2400/4800/9600/57600/115200).
- IMAGE RANGE [FULL/COMP/USER] : Adjust the rate of YC signal to 100%(FULL), 75%(COMP) or 100%~75%(USER).
- COLOR SPACE [YUV/SD-CBCR/HD-CBCR] : Select different color settings for a warmer or a colder image.
- FRAME RATE [25 FPS/30 FPS] : Choose a frame rate.
- CVBS [PAL/NTSC] : Select the video format that matches the present TV system.
- LANGUAGE : ENG, CHN, CHN(S), JPN, KOR
- COLOR BAR [OFF/ON] : Check current condition with color bar.
- RESET [ON] : All settings will be restored to factory default.
